About Epsom Downs Community School & Early Years Centres

Epsom Downs Community School & Early Years Centres is a mixed state primary for ages 3-11 in Reigate and Banstead, Surrey. While the school does not have a published parentView recommendation percentage in its data, its oversubscription ratio is not provided either, so gauging local demand from that metric alone isn't possible. However, the school's Good Ofsted rating, held since at least its 2014 graded inspection and confirmed as remaining Good in an ungraded visit in December 2018, suggests a consistent standard that parents can rely on. The school has a nursery provision, which may appeal to families looking for continuity from early years through to Year 6. With a capacity of 472, it is a relatively large primary, and its headteacher is Anya Salisbury. The school does not have a religious character, so it will suit families seeking a non-denominational setting.

Academically, the school's most recent Ofsted inspection in 2014 gave it a Good overall effectiveness, with leadership and management also rated Good. Early years provision was rated Good in that inspection, though it had been Outstanding in the previous 2009 inspection. The school offers a range of facilities including a library, sensory room, playing fields, gymnasium, sports hall, ICT suite, music rooms, and a chapel. Sports provision covers athletics, swimming, gymnastics, and dance, while clubs include book club, coding, and film club. The sensory room is a notable provision that may support children with additional sensory needs. With nursery provision on site, it could suit families wanting a single setting from age 3.
